Monthly Cost of Living

A single person spends $855 per month in Da Nang vs $746 in Alabang, rent included.

A couple spends around $1,389 per month in Da Nang vs $1,120 in Alabang, rent included.

A family of three spends $1,923 per month in Da Nang vs $1,495 in Alabang, rent included.

Da Nang costs about 15% more than Alabang, driven mainly by Clothing & Footwear.

Both Da Nang and Alabang are more affordable than the global median – Da Nang 38% lower, Alabang 46% lower.

Cost Breakdown

A central one-bedroom costs $531 in Da Nang versus $226 in Alabang.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.

A mid-range dinner for two costs $19.00 in Da Nang versus $19.00 in Alabang. Groceries tell a different story – $197 in Da Nang vs $169 in Alabang – so Alabang wins on supermarket bills even if dining out costs more.
